  The first step towards a successful root canal treatment involves a comprehensive consultation with your dentist or endodontist. During this session, the dentist will review your dental health history, including any previous treatments and existing conditions that may affect the procedure. This dialogue establishes a clear understanding of what is to come, ensuring you are well-informed.

  Moreover, discussing your concerns, questions, and any fears you may have is vital. This open communication helps in creating a tailored treatment plan and sets expectations about the pain management strategies that will be used during the procedure, thereby reducing anxiety.

  Lastly, ensure that your dental provider explains what the treatment entails, including risks and benefits. Understanding the procedure will arm you with valuable insights and empower you to make informed decisions, enhancing your comfort level before the treatment begins.

  

2. Diagnostic Imaging Importance

  Before a root canal treatment, diagnostic imaging such as X-rays is crucial. These images allow your dentist to visualize the internal structure of your teeth, including the root canals, and assess the extent of any infection or damage. Proper imaging can significantly impact the treatments direction.

  By identifying the complications early and accurately, the dentist can devise a more effective treatment strategy that may involve the use of specific techniques or tools that fit your unique dental structure. This increases the chances of a successful outcome and promotes less discomfort during the procedure.

  Additionally, having these diagnostic insights can reduce the number of follow-up visits required, thus saving you both time and effort. This clear pre-procedure picture helps build a smoother path toward achieving optimal results.

  

3. Mental and Physical Preparation

  Mental preparation plays an integral role in how patients perceive and endure dental procedures. Techniques such as mindfulness and relaxation exercises can be beneficial in alleviating anxiety leading up to the appointment. It is advisable to practice calming strategies, such as deep breathing or visualization techniques, to help maintain a sense of peace.

  Physical preparation is equally important. Make sure to have a good night’s sleep prior to the treatment and consider having a light meal unless advised otherwise by your dentist. Being well-rested and nourished can promote heightened tolerance during the procedure and allow your body to handle any potential stress more effectively.

  Moreover, consider bringing a supportive friend or family member along to your appointment. Their presence can provide emotional reassurance, making the entire experience less intimidating. Together, these strategies will enhance your preparedness for the procedure and promote an overall sense of comfort.

  

4. Structured Aftercare Planning

  Aftercare is often overlooked when preparing for root canal treatment; however, proper planning is essential for optimal recovery. Post-procedure, you may experience discomfort or swelling, so it’s vital to have a clear plan for pain management. Your dentist may prescribe medications or recommend over-the-counter pain relievers to help mitigate discomfort.

  In addition, arrange for someone to drive you home after the procedure, especially if sedation is used. This ensures you have a safe mode of transportation and allows you time to recover while avoiding additional stress.

  Lastly, adhere strictly to any aftercare instructions provided by your dental team. This may include dietary restrictions, maintaining oral hygiene, and scheduling follow-up appointments for monitoring your recovery. Following these guidelines is crucial to ensure that the treated area heals properly and efficiently.
